When information is 'furnished' under Item 2.02 of Form 8-K, it means the company is providing the information to the SEC but it is generally not subject to the liabilities under Section 18 of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, nor is it automatically incorporated into other SEC filings unless specifically referenced. This is a common practice for earnings press releases.
